Life in the 21st century often feels like a never-ending race against the clock. From the moment we wake up, we are bombarded with tasks, deadlines, and obligations that keep us perpetually on the move. The constant state of rush can take a toll on our physical and mental health, leaving us feeling exhausted and disconnected from ourselves.

Cultivating mindfulness amidst the chaos is one way we can navigate the hurried nature of modern life. By intentionally paying attention to the present moment without judgment, we can become more aware of our thoughts, feelings, and bodily sensations. This heightened awareness allows us to make conscious choices and prioritize what truly matters to us.

Incorporating simple practices such as deep breathing, meditation, and mindful movement into our daily routines can help us break free from the grip of hurry. These activities provide moments of stillness and reflection, allowing us to rejuvenate our minds and bodies. Moreover, adopting time management techniques, setting realistic goals, and learning to say no can also alleviate the pressures of a busy lifestyle.

Slowing down doesn’t mean becoming unproductive or lazy; rather, it means finding a balance between productivity and self-care. By intentionally slowing our pace, we can savor life’s simple pleasures, nurture our relationships, and safeguard our well-being. Embracing mindful living in a world of hurry enables us to find peace amidst the chaos and restore harmony to our lives.#18#

Living in a constant state of hurry has become an unavoidable part of modern society. From meeting deadlines to juggling multiple responsibilities, we often find ourselves trapped in a relentless cycle of rushing. However, this hurried lifestyle takes a toll on our physical and mental health.

The constant pressure to do things quickly not only raises stress levels but also hinders productivity and creativity. In our quest for efficiency, we often compromise on quality, leading to diminished outcomes. Moreover, always rushing from one task to another leaves little room for self-care, resulting in a neglected well-being.

Slowing down and prioritizing self-care is crucial for maintaining a balanced life. Embracing mindfulness practices can help us regain control over our lives. By being fully present in each moment, we become more aware of our thoughts, emotions, and physical sensations, allowing us to respond to situations with clarity and calmness.

Making time for activities that bring us joy and relaxation is equally important. Engaging in hobbies, spending quality time with loved ones, or simply appreciating the beauty of nature can restore our energy and boost our overall well-being. Taking moments to pause and appreciate life’s simpler pleasures can provide a much-needed respite from the constant hurrying.

In conclusion, the constant hurry of our fast-paced lifestyle can have detrimental effects on our well-being. By recognizing the perils of this rushed existence and prioritizing self-care through mindfulness and balance, we can lead happier, healthier lives. So, let us all take a step back, slow down, and rediscover the beauty of being truly present in the moment.#18#

Do you find yourself constantly rushing from one task to the next, always in a hurry to get things done? While it may seem like a productive way to operate, constantly being in a rush can actually hinder your success in the long run.

When you are in a constant state of hurry, you are more likely to make mistakes, overlook important details, and ultimately decrease your overall productivity. Additionally, the stress of always rushing can lead to burnout and negatively impact your mental and physical well-being.

Slowing down and taking the time to focus on each task can actually lead to better results. By giving yourself the time and space to fully concentrate on the task at hand, you are more likely to produce high-quality work and achieve success in the long run.

So next time you feel the urge to hurry through something, take a moment to pause and consider the benefits of slowing down. Remember, success is not always about speed, but about putting in the time and effort to do things right.#18#
